Club website has a list of players released: Castillo gone back from whence he came (Red Star Belgrade), Valente and vd Meyde released, along with Scott Spencer (never became the player he looked like at 16), JP Kissock (never became the player he was in his own head), defenders John Irving and Cory Sinnott and Irish winger Eunan O'Kane, along with some academy kids.

Interestingly, Lars Jacobsen seems to have been retained, so I assume we're in discussions to keep him- there were rumours at one point he was going to Bayern Munich, but they now seem to be after Bosingwa from Chelsea.

John, JP Kissock went to Accrington Stanley who couldn?t afford to keep him. He got a few good reviews including one from ex-England U-21 coach Peter Taylor, now manager of Wycombe who said he was the best player on the pitch when they played them. It?s his size that has stopped him from advancing at Everton. He?s had a number of clubs interested and I am sure if he gets a run of games, he?ll prove he?s a decent player.
